When driving fuel would leak out of pipe. Also, whenever vehicle was filled with fuel, could smell fumes, and fuel would spill from T top and drip down to side of vehicle. Dealership refused to repair vehicle becaus eit was not bought there.
Fuel tank leaked gas around seals. Filler tube connected to tank, the seal failed. Dealer contacted and aware of problem. Repairwork done at owners expense.
Consumer noticed fuel leaking from the filler neck of the vehicle, consumer has contacted the dealer, dealer stated that the leak was due to over filling of the tank.
